What to check before for buildings near the B train in Manhattan

  • Start with the B-train proximity filter, then compare commute times on each building’s page (street, cross-streets, and transit access notes).
  • Verify the full move-in cost beyond the asking rent: typical deposits, application fees, and any broker-related costs can change the monthly total.
  • Before signing, confirm lease terms and renewal expectations directly with management (especially if you’re trying to line up a start date).
  • If a building is pet-friendly or has building amenities listed, check the exact rules on the building page and confirm any breed/weight/count limits and required documentation.
